Sorry strange question here but on the verge of seriously trying to Potty Train DS he's 2.6 so think its about time, when we take his nappy off and leave the potty out hes quite happy to do a wee. However he always does it stood up, he just wont sit down to know thats probably not a bad thing but I am little worried about what happens when he wants to do a number 2 and wont sit down!!!!!

Any ideas on getting him to sit down!!!

Put the potty in front of the TV or wherever he would naturally sit (no, not at the dinner table for Sunday lunch )

It's best to teach them to sit, their aim is appalling!

I am finding the toilet much easier than pottys (I'm currently training DD) as you can put a step under their feet so they can get on and off easily and then call it a 'throne'.

We now have a 'toilet crown' (Well it does seem to be encouraging her to go at least!)
